Course & Workshop Program
The course and workshop format includes didactic presentations, technical demonstrations, nerve conductions and needle EMG videos, and discussions and workshops in a group setting to ensure optimal learning and participation. Participants will have the opportunity to interact directly with faculty during these discussions and hands-on demonstrations.
